"Decoction" is a word in LAW AND LEGAL, ENGLISH
The act of boiling a sub-stance in water, for extracting its virtues. Also the liquor in which a substance has been boiled; water impregnated with the prlnci-ples of any animal or vegetable substance boiled in it webster; Sykes v. Magone (C. O.) 38 Fed. 497
An extract got from a body by boiling it in water.
The act or process of boiling anything in a watery fluid
to extract its virtues.
